The challenge
Good café staff do two jobs at once. They sell, by recommending the things people will love, and they keep customers safe, by getting allergen questions right. Both rely on genuinely knowing the menu, which is hard when new products come and go and training is usually a quick word from whoever is on shift.
This sample project imagined a bakery café, Crumb Eatery, that wanted its team to talk about the food with confidence and never guess when someone asks what is in it.
What we did
We built the course around the menu itself. Flip-card product profiles introduce the bestsellers, what goes into them and the allergens to flag, so staff learn the detail in a format that is quick to revisit. Friendly, practical tips, like knowing which items are vegan or gluten-free before a customer asks, turn knowledge into better service.
The whole module is dressed in the café's warm, handmade brand, so it feels like part of the place rather than a generic food-safety course.
The result
The training is built to make staff both more helpful and safer: confident enough to recommend, and accurate enough to be trusted on allergens. Turning product knowledge into a short, on-brand experience is designed to make it something new starters actually finish.
